Output 88c5421128cbbd48aed1fc9af5c8a18216aa622f8412675ad164d55176123913:0

value
1059623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3fc666c1a4fd6a12a0e36a5e1c5b380d31d87ad OP_EQUAL
address
3KZJ41tfzMHCU1zVM9nWhuAUhY4Paz3qxE
transaction
88c5421128cbbd48aed1fc9af5c8a18216aa622f8412675ad164d55176123913
spent
true